Alabama Administrative Code
Title 610 - ALABAMA BOARD OF NURSING
Chapter 610-X-10 - CONTINUING EDUCATION FOR LICENSURE
Section 610-X-10-.04 - Acceptable Providers Of Continuing Education

(1) Board-approved continuing education providers that have an assigned ABNP number and meet the standards of this chapter.
(2) Providers of continuing education recognized by the Board.
(a) Continuing education approved by any
state board of nursing in the United States or its territories.
(b) Continuing education approved by national
associations or organizations that are accredited by a national continuing
education body. Any continuing education provider approved by the American
Nurses Credentialing Center (ANCC) or the International Association of
Continuing Education and Training (IACET) shall be recognized by the Board if
the content requirements are met pursuant to this chapter.
(c) National nursing organizations that
approve providers of continuing education or offer continuing education are
recognized by the Board.
(d)
Continuing education provided by an Alabama regulatory board shall be
recognized by the Board.
(e) AMA
PRA Category 1 Credits sponsored or conducted by those organizations or
entities accredited by the Council on Medical Education of the Medical
Association of the State of Alabama or by the Accreditation Council for
Continuing Medical Education (ACCME).
(f) Standardized national courses approved by
a national organization that establishes the standardized course. The maximum
number of contact hours the Board shall recognize, unless a Board-approved
provider awards more, are listed for each course.
1. Basic Life Support Healthcare Provider
Initial Course: 4.5 contact hours.
2. Basic Life Support Healthcare Provider
Renewal Course: 3 contact hours.
3.
Advanced Cardiac Life Support Initial Course: 13.5 contact hours.
4. Advanced Cardiac Life Support Renewal
Course: 9 contact hours.
5.
Pediatric Advanced Life Support Initial Course: 14 contact hours.
6. Pediatric Advanced Life Support Renewal
Course: 8.5 contact hours with optional lessons; 6.5 contact hours without the
optional lessons.
7. Instructor
Course: Core Instructor Course: 8 contact hours plus discipline specific
component.
8. Advanced Cardiac Life
Support Instructor Course- discipline specific component: 7.5 contact
hours.
9. Basic Life Support
Instructor Course-discipline specific component: 5.5 contact hours.
10. Pediatric Advanced Life Support
Instructor Course-discipline specific component: 9.5 contact hours.
11. Electrocardiography (ECG) and
Pharmacology: 6.25 contact hours.
12. Electrocardiography: 3.5 contact
hours.
13. Pharmacology: 2.75
hours.
14. Pediatric Emergency,
Assessment, Recognition and Stabilization (PEARS): 7 contact hours.
15. Trauma Nursing Core Course (TNCC): 14.42
contact hours.
16. Emergency
Nursing Pediatric Course (ENPC): 15.33 contact hours.
17. Course in Advanced Trauma Nursing (CATN):
13 hours.
18. Cardiopulmonary
Resuscitation/Automatic External Defibrillator (CPR/AED) for Professional
Rescuer: 8 contact hours for initial course or four (4) contact hours for
review/update course
19. Instructor
Course for CPR/AED for Professional Rescuer: 16 contact hours
20. International Trauma Life Support
(i) International Trauma Life Support-
Advanced Provider: 16 contact hours
(ii) International Trauma Life Support -
Instructor: 8 contact hours
(iii)
International Trauma Life Support Pediatric - Provider: 8 contact
hours
21. Neonatal
advanced life support or neonatal resuscitation program: The Board may
recognize the total contact hours awarded by a Board-approved or
Board-recognized provider.
(g) State Nurses Associations.
(h) Continuing education provided by colleges
and universities that are accredited by an organization recognized by the U.S.
Department of Education and have continuing education as part of their
mission.
Author: Alabama Board of Nursing
Statutory Authority: Code of Ala. 1975, §§ 34-21-2, 34-21-23(f).
